Ryan Zhao
							
						 
						
							 
							
							
							
								
							
								5bb287f258 
								
							
								 
							
						 
						
							
							
								
								fix an issue where rejected message requests will come back on linked devices  
							
							 
							
							
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								Ryan Zhao
							
						 
						
							 
							
							
							
								
							
								8db281e42f 
								
							
								 
							
						 
						
							
							
								
								hide disappearing message settings when current thread is blocked  
							
							 
							
							
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								ryanzhao
							
						 
						
							 
							
							
							
								
							
								8557604064 
								
							
								 
							
						 
						
							
							
								
								clean up  
							
							 
							
							
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								Ryan Zhao
							
						 
						
							 
							
							
							
								
							
								37dc1631b5 
								
							
								 
							
						 
						
							
							
								
								fix an issue where the textview is not scrollable after the app goes into background and goes back in foreground.  
							
							 
							
							
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								Ryan Zhao
							
						 
						
							 
							
							
							
								
							
								fa9de8c9c3 
								
							
								 
							
						 
						
							
							
								
								Merge branch 'dev' into bug-fixes-1.11.25  
							
							 
							
							
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								RyanZhao
							
						 
						
							 
							
							
								
								
							
							
								
							
								2260e76dd5 
								
									
								
							
								 
							
						 
						
							
							
								
								Merge pull request  #613  from mpretty-cyro/fix/linkPreviewDarkModeText  
							
							 
							
							... 
							
							
							
							Fix link preview dark mode text 
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								Morgan Pretty
							
						 
						
							 
							
							
							
								
							
								dbb0cdf0cb 
								
							
								 
							
						 
						
							
							
								
								Fixed an issue where the text on the LinkPreview in dark mode wasn't visible  
							
							 
							
							
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								Ryan Zhao
							
						 
						
							 
							
							
							
								
							
								77c00b6c37 
								
							
								 
							
						 
						
							
							
								
								fix   #456  
							
							 
							
							
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								Ryan Zhao
							
						 
						
							 
							
							
							
								
							
								43ca54c0a0 
								
							
								 
							
						 
						
							
							
								
								refactor to use Atomic wrapper  
							
							 
							
							
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								Ryan Zhao
							
						 
						
							 
							
							
							
								
							
								a22dc15249 
								
							
								 
							
						 
						
							
							
								
								fix closed group poller unwrapping crash in background  
							
							 
							
							
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								Morgan Pretty
							
						 
						
							 
							
							
							
								
							
								7256cc6871 
								
							
								 
							
						 
						
							
							
								
								Merge remote-tracking branch 'upstream/dev' into dev  
							
							 
							
							
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								RyanZhao
							
						 
						
							 
							
							
								
								
							
							
								
							
								cd3c385444 
								
									
								
							
								 
							
						 
						
							
							
								
								Merge pull request  #610  from mpretty-cyro/feature/remove-unused-code  
							
							 
							
							... 
							
							
							
							Remove unused code 
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								Morgan Pretty
							
						 
						
							 
							
							
							
								
							
								1633105ce2 
								
							
								 
							
						 
						
							
							
								
								Merge branch 'dev' into feature/remove-unused-code  
							
							 
							
							... 
							
							
							
							# Conflicts:
#	Session/Backups/OWSBackup.m
#	Session/Backups/OWSBackupImportJob.m
#	SignalUtilitiesKit/Sharing/SelectRecipientViewController.m
#	SignalUtilitiesKit/Sharing/SelectThreadViewController.m 
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								Morgan Pretty
							
						 
						
							 
							
							
							
								
							
								459502f1c3 
								
							
								 
							
						 
						
							
							
								
								Merge remote-tracking branch 'upstream/dev' into dev  
							
							 
							
							
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								RyanZhao
							
						 
						
							 
							
							
								
								
							
							
								
							
								82606a6244 
								
									
								
							
								 
							
						 
						
							
							
								
								Merge pull request  #602  from mpretty-cyro/feature/remove-OWSBlockingManager  
							
							 
							
							... 
							
							
							
							Remove the OWSBlockingManager 
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								Morgan Pretty
							
						 
						
							 
							
							
							
								
							
								89e80da625 
								
							
								 
							
						 
						
							
							
								
								Removed AppPreferences (unused)  
							
							 
							
							
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								Morgan Pretty
							
						 
						
							 
							
							
							
								
							
								f7091dca28 
								
							
								 
							
						 
						
							
							
								
								Removed an empty notification observer  
							
							 
							
							
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								Morgan Pretty
							
						 
						
							 
							
							
							
								
							
								0842dbff1e 
								
							
								 
							
						 
						
							
							
								
								Removed a bunch of unused code  
							
							 
							
							... 
							
							
							
							Removed the legacy Theme code (replaced with SessionUIKit equivalents)
Removed the OWSOrphanDataCleaner (unused)
Removed the OWSReceiptType_Delivery from the OWSOutgoingReceiptManager (unused)
Removed the TSStorageKeys and TSStorageHeaders files (unused)
Removed the LKMessageIDCollection (unused - only had methods for deleting data from the collection)
Removed the OWSPrimaryStorageTrustedKeysCollection and OWSIdentityManager_QueuedVerificationStateSyncMessages (unused)
Removed collections and notifications from OWSProfileManager (unused) 
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								Morgan Pretty
							
						 
						
							 
							
							
							
								
							
								9e3c02f79b 
								
							
								 
							
						 
						
							
							
								
								Removed the unused legacy OWSBackup code  
							
							 
							
							
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								Morgan Pretty
							
						 
						
							 
							
							
							
								
							
								0e09d4b935 
								
							
								 
							
						 
						
							
							
								
								Merge remote-tracking branch 'upstream/dev' into dev  
							
							 
							
							
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								ryanzhao
							
						 
						
							 
							
							
							
								
							
								548aad69a9 
								
							
								 
							
						 
						
							
							
								
								update build number  
							
							 
							
							
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								RyanZhao
							
						 
						
							 
							
							
								
								
							
							
								
							
								b281ea528a 
								
									
								
							
								 
							
						 
						
							
							
								
								Merge pull request  #609  from RyanRory/fix-message-requests-reverse  
							
							 
							
							... 
							
							
							
							Fix approved chats back to message requests inbox 
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								ryanzhao
							
						 
						
							 
							
							
							
								
							
								801f0d68a8 
								
							
								 
							
						 
						
							
							
								
								fix an edge case where a config message might get isApproved set to false  
							
							 
							
							
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								Morgan Pretty
							
						 
						
							 
							
							
							
								
							
								21924ee81a 
								
							
								 
							
						 
						
							
							
								
								Merge branch 'dev' into feature/remove-OWSBlockingManager  
							
							 
							
							... 
							
							
							
							# Conflicts:
#	Session.xcodeproj/project.pbxproj 
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								Morgan Pretty
							
						 
						
							 
							
							
							
								
							
								1b5eea7b4f 
								
							
								 
							
						 
						
							
							
								
								Merge remote-tracking branch 'upstream/dev' into dev  
							
							 
							
							
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								Ryan Zhao
							
						 
						
							 
							
							
							
								
							
								59f112c55f 
								
							
								 
							
						 
						
							
							
								
								bump up version & build number  
							
							 
							
							
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								RyanZhao
							
						 
						
							 
							
							
								
								
							
							
								
							
								7cd0079b37 
								
									
								
							
								 
							
						 
						
							
							
								
								Merge pull request  #599  from mpretty-cyro/fix/update-last-message-hash-after-registering-jobs  
							
							 
							
							... 
							
							
							
							Fix - Update last message hash after registering jobs 
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								RyanZhao
							
						 
						
							 
							
							
								
								
							
							
								
							
								74f1d9a6d4 
								
									
								
							
								 
							
						 
						
							
							
								
								Merge pull request  #596  from mpretty-cyro/feature/improve-open-group-deletion-processing  
							
							 
							
							... 
							
							
							
							Performance: Improve open group deletion processing 
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								RyanZhao
							
						 
						
							 
							
							
								
								
							
							
								
							
								f05c695756 
								
									
								
							
								 
							
						 
						
							
							
								
								Merge pull request  #588  from mpretty-cyro/fix/message-request-count-bug  
							
							 
							
							... 
							
							
							
							Performance: Count unread message requests thread-first rather than unread-message-first 
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								Morgan Pretty
							
						 
						
							 
							
							
							
								
							
								7165b9e4f6 
								
							
								 
							
						 
						
							
							
								
								Merge branch 'dev' into feature/remove-OWSBlockingManager  
							
							 
							
							... 
							
							
							
							# Conflicts:
#	Session/Conversations/ConversationVC+Interaction.swift
#	Session/Meta/AppDelegate.swift
#	SessionMessagingKit/Messages/Control Messages/ConfigurationMessage+Convenience.swift
#	SessionMessagingKit/Sending & Receiving/MessageReceiver+Handling.swift 
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								Morgan Pretty
							
						 
						
							 
							
							
							
								
							
								2530cb4492 
								
							
								 
							
						 
						
							
							
								
								Merge remote-tracking branch 'upstream/dev' into dev  
							
							 
							
							
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								RyanZhao
							
						 
						
							 
							
							
								
								
							
							
								
							
								8daf804fd5 
								
									
								
							
								 
							
						 
						
							
							
								
								Merge pull request  #597  from mpretty-cyro/fix/ui-call-running-on-background-thread  
							
							 
							
							... 
							
							
							
							Fix for a UI call running on background thread 
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								RyanZhao
							
						 
						
							 
							
							
								
								
							
							
								
							
								7c18609aa8 
								
									
								
							
								 
							
						 
						
							
							
								
								Merge pull request  #601  from mpretty-cyro/fix/double-url-share  
							
							 
							
							... 
							
							
							
							Fix double url share 
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								RyanZhao
							
						 
						
							 
							
							
								
								
							
							
								
							
								3e20519a6a 
								
									
								
							
								 
							
						 
						
							
							
								
								Merge pull request  #603  from mpretty-cyro/fix/link-preview-crash  
							
							 
							
							... 
							
							
							
							Fix link preview crash 
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								RyanZhao
							
						 
						
							 
							
							
								
								
							
							
								
							
								0f34972134 
								
									
								
							
								 
							
						 
						
							
							
								
								Merge pull request  #604  from mpretty-cyro/fix/tweaks-to-config-message-generation  
							
							 
							
							... 
							
							
							
							Tweaks to config message generation 
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								Morgan Pretty
							
						 
						
							 
							
							
							
								
							
								3663e63bc7 
								
							
								 
							
						 
						
							
							
								
								Swapped the Config message 'filter' to a 'compactMap' because apparently that doesn't crash  
							
							 
							
							
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								Morgan Pretty
							
						 
						
							 
							
							
							
								
							
								e4def22472 
								
							
								 
							
						 
						
							
							
								
								Moved the Storage.write call into the `self.approveMessageRequestIfNeeded` call  
							
							 
							
							
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								Morgan Pretty
							
						 
						
							 
							
							
							
								
							
								212c5e87aa 
								
							
								 
							
						 
						
							
							
								
								Re-added the transaction requirement when generating the current config message  
							
							 
							
							
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								Morgan Pretty
							
						 
						
							 
							
							
							
								
							
								29c53223e0 
								
							
								 
							
						 
						
							
							
								
								More tweaks to fix crash  
							
							 
							
							... 
							
							
							
							Wrapped the force sync calls within their own Storage.write blocks to ensure they have the latest data and aren't accessing a transaction completed in a different thread
Reverted a number of the unneeded changes 
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								Morgan Pretty
							
						 
						
							 
							
							
							
								
							
								b815a9f348 
								
							
								 
							
						 
						
							
							
								
								Fixed up a potential threading issue with the sync configuration logic  
							
							 
							
							... 
							
							
							
							Moved all the sync configuration calls to be within the existing 'write' blocks instead of waiting until the completion 
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								Morgan Pretty
							
						 
						
							 
							
							
							
								
							
								1214005c59 
								
							
								 
							
						 
						
							
							
								
								Updated the cachedEncodedPublicKey to be Atomic  
							
							 
							
							... 
							
							
							
							Added the Atomic wrapper for thread safe variables 
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								Morgan Pretty
							
						 
						
							 
							
							
							
								
							
								f8dfbd4244 
								
							
								 
							
						 
						
							
							
								
								Reverting change and fixing a force-cast crash  
							
							 
							
							
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								Morgan Pretty
							
						 
						
							 
							
							
							
								
							
								6205e72eab 
								
							
								 
							
						 
						
							
							
								
								Change to make the 'getUser(using:)' method more consistent  
							
							 
							
							
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								Morgan Pretty
							
						 
						
							 
							
							
							
								
							
								7aa1221987 
								
							
								 
							
						 
						
							
							
								
								Tweaks to the ConfigurationMessage generation logic  
							
							 
							
							... 
							
							
							
							Removed force unwraps
Updated the closed group storage methods to take a transaction parameter 
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								Morgan Pretty
							
						 
						
							 
							
							
							
								
							
								990edd20df 
								
							
								 
							
						 
						
							
							
								
								Swapped a force-unwrap to an optional unwrap  
							
							 
							
							
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								Morgan Pretty
							
						 
						
							 
							
							
							
								
							
								5bb3bd7bc1 
								
							
								 
							
						 
						
							
							
								
								Cleaned up some config sync logic and allowed migrations to trigger them  
							
							 
							
							... 
							
							
							
							Updated the migrations so they can specify whether a configuration sync is required
Moved the config sync logic into a MessageSender extension (makes far more sense than AppDelegate)
Fixed a bug where the ShareVC was triggering the 'versionMigrationsDidComplete' twice
Removed a couple of imports for files that had been deleted 
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								Morgan Pretty
							
						 
						
							 
							
							
							
								
							
								e7e8aba69a 
								
							
								 
							
						 
						
							
							
								
								Fixed a bug where sharing a url with LinkPreviews disabled could result in it being duplicated in the message  
							
							 
							
							
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								Morgan Pretty
							
						 
						
							 
							
							
							
								
							
								78c0d000be 
								
							
								 
							
						 
						
							
							
								
								Removed the OWSBlockingManager replacing it with the config sync  
							
							 
							
							... 
							
							
							
							Fixed an issue where the "block" button would appear in the NoteToSelf swipe menu
Removed the OWSBlockingManager and supporting files
Removed a number of unused classes and methods
Refactored the BlockListUIUtils to Swift 
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								Morgan Pretty
							
						 
						
							 
							
							
							
								
							
								b90904ebbd 
								
							
								 
							
						 
						
							
							
								
								Updated the code to only update the last message hash once the MessageReceiveJobs have been created  
							
							 
							
							
							
						 
						
							4 years ago  
						
					 
				
					
						
							
							
								 
								Morgan Pretty
							
						 
						
							 
							
							
							
								
							
								01742af16b 
								
							
								 
							
						 
						
							
							
								
								Added an initial call to `isRTL` on the main thread to prevent a background thread calling it first  
							
							 
							
							
							
						 
						
							4 years ago